US mortgage fixed rates rise on Sept 1, with 30-year at 6.59%, following weekend airstrikes near Hormuz
According to the Zillow lender marketplace, the average 30-year fixed rate increased by four basis points to 6.59%. The 15-year fixed loan rose nine basis points to 6%. These movements follow U.S. airstrikes on Iranian rocket launchers over the weekend near the Strait of Hormuz.
